Depending on the number of guests and purpose,
You can choose from two types of rooms.
Kyakuden

The Kyakuden is a spacious traditional Japanese room. It consists of four small and medium-sized rooms separated by a fusuma (Japanese sliding door), and can be used flexibly according to the number of people and purposes.
■ BBQ Use:
For an additional fee of ¥3000 (tax included), you can use one campsite and the following sets.
・Barbecue set (stove, grate, 3kg of charcoal, fire tongs);
・Bench set (table & two benches)
Note: Available only if there are vacant campsites.

Hanare

The Hanare is a moderately spacious Japanese-style room. It is located right next to the main hall, and there is a private restroom in the room.
We offer the Zazen Hall as accommodation for volunteers, WWOOFers, and those visiting for service worship. For more details, please contact us with your inquiries.
